00:01On the occasion of Kargil Vijay Divas, television and film actor Gurmeet Chaudhary has posted a
00:07collection of pictures on social media to show his love and gratitude towards the nation.
00:12The actor on Sunday took to his social media platform and posted some heartfelt pictures
00:17and wrote in the caption, Today on Kargil Vijay Divas my heart is filled with gratitude and pride.
00:24I was born in an army hospital, studied in an army school, grew up among soldiers and their families
00:30and witnessed first-hand the discipline, sacrifice and courage that defined our armed forces.
00:37That's why wearing the Indian Army uniform on screen has never felt like just another role.
00:42Whether it was Spelton or any other soldier, I have had the honor to portray every time I wore the
00:48uniform. It came with immense responsibility, respect and emotion.
00:53To every brave heart who fought for our wayshed, to the heroes who made the ultimate sacrifice,
00:58and to every soldier who continues to protect us today, thank you. We sleep peacefully because you
01:04stand awake. Jai Hind
01:08The poster series features some beautiful and heartwarming snapshots of the actor dressed in
01:12a full military attire from the sets of his film Pulton. He was seen essaying the role of Captain
01:18Prithvi Singh Dagar with pride and intensity.
01:21But the real showstopper in these slides were the army soldiers, who posed happily with him,
01:27urging warmth and pride to every frame. On the professional work front, the actor,
01:32before landing into larger roles, appeared in early television and Tamil fantasy series,
01:37Mayavi. But he later achieved his breakthrough in the year 2008,
01:41when he played the role of Lord Rama in the hit series Ramayana.
